León Benavente version “Fukushima” of Bizarro Love Triangle

The band Benavente León adds to tribute to Bizarro love triangle With his interpretation of the theme “Fukushima”.

Benavente León They present their version of “Fukushima” as part of the tribute to Bizarro love trianglewhich this year celebrates its twenty -one years of career. The commemorative project will culminate in November With a compilation album that will include exclusive versions of songs from all its albums.

“Fukushima” is one of the songs that was part of “Bizarro love triangle”the album that the Galicians published in 2020 by Mushroom Pillow.

After Parksvr, Benavente León It is the second confirmed band of a total of eighteen that will participate in this tribute. The names of the rest of the artists will be revealed in the coming weeks.
